Hormel Foods (HRL) CEO James Snee plans to retire at the end of fiscal 2025, the company said Tuesday.
Snee has worked at Hormel for 36 years, eight of which have been as CEO. The Spam and Skippy parent said it has formed a search committee to identify a successor, and Snee has agreed to remain with the company as a strategic advisor for 18 months following his departure.
Hormel said its outlook for fiscal 2025, which ends in late October, remains unchanged. Last month, the company projected full-year net sales of $11.9 billion to $12.2 billion and earnings per share (EPS) of $1.51 to $1.65.
Hormel Foods shares were 1% lower Tuesday morning. They are down about 6% over the last year.
